In this episode of Savor the Ozarks, Joy Robertson sits down with Stacey Schneider, owner of Pizza House, a Springfield staple with a 65-year history. Starting as a 15-year-old employee in the late ‘80s, Stacy worked her way up to owner, keeping the iconic thin-crust, square-cut pizzas and the original 1958 phone number alive!From its beginnings on Bennett and Glenstone to its quick-moving relocation to Commercial Street, Pizza House has stayed true to its roots while serving three generations of loyal customers.
